Living Here

Barringella is a suburb of New South Wales, home to about 30 people, with a median age of 52. The typical household earns around $2,624 a week, with median rent near $300 a week. Most homes are houses. About 100% of households own their home and 0% rent. Most workers drive to work. Common community backgrounds include English, Australian, Aboriginal. On the ABS socio-economic scale it sits in decile 9 of 10 nationally — a relatively advantaged area.
